Reclamation has obtained a permanent easement for the construction and operation of the <br />Durango Pumping Plant from the Animas-La Plata Water Conservancy District. For <br />purposes of this specification land owner will be referenced as the Government. <br /> <br />B. <br /> <br />The permanent easement has several restrictions within it: (i) not to use the property for <br />any purpose other than public purposes as required by UMTRCA, 42 U.S.C. g 7901 et <br />sea., as amended; (ii) not to use ground water from the site for any purpose, and not to <br />construct wells or any means of exposing ground water to the surface unless prior written <br />approval is given by the Colorado Department of Public Health and Environment and the <br />U.S. Department of Energy; (iii) not to sell or transfer the land to anyone other than a <br />governmental entity within the state; (iv) not to perform construction of any kind on the <br />property unless prior written approval of construction plans, designs and specifications <br />is given by Grantor and the U.S. Department of Energy; (v) that any habitable structures <br />constructed on the property shall employ a radon ventilation system or other radon <br />mitigation measures; and (vi) that its use of the property shall not adversely impact <br />groundwater quality nor interfere with groundwater remediation under UMTRCA. <br />Reclamation is in the process of obtaining written approval of construction plans, designs, <br />and specifications from CDPHE and DOE to include the above concerns. <br /> <br />( <br /> <br />C. The proposed Durango Pumping Plant site is in an area where solid residual radioactive <br />materials have been removed by DOE and CDPHE under the UMTRA project. The <br />remediation was conducted in accordance with regulations promulgated by the United <br />States Environmental Protection Agency (EPA), in 40 CFR 192. After contaminated <br />soils were removed from the site, clean backfill was placed in sorne areas to restore the <br />topography. <br /> <br />D. During construction of the pumping plant, the Contractor may encounter anyone the <br />following soil/rock types: I) clean backfill; 2) clean bedrock or native materials; 3) <br />soils/rock with 6.6 pCi/g Radium or less; or 4) soils/rock exceeding 6.6 pCilg Radium <br />buried at depths greater than 6 inches. There is also the remote possibility of <br />encountering residual materials in excess of the standards. In addition, one area of the <br />site, known as grid H-38-20, was found to contain Thorium-230 in concentrations that <br />slightly exceed the cleanup standards. <br /> <br />Use of Site <br />01141 - 2 <br />
